I killed my 320gb
The other night I was playing round with my PC, and I plugged my 320gb in but the computer wouldn’t turn on. It just made a zoom sound and then died. Somewhere in the PSU. And I had to turn it off at the PSU, and then turn it back on, and then try to turn it on again before it would make the noise again.
I was like wtf? So I looked at the connection and somehow the plug from the Molex–>SATA had gotten “un-keyed” and managed to get itself plugged in the wrong way. So I was shooting 12v up the 5v and 5 volt up the 12v. Needless to say the drive don’t go.
But I tried plugging it into my portable molex PSU, a little powerpack with a 240 in and comes out in a 12v/5v molex and it didn’t turn off – not that advanced. However some little voltage regulators on the hard drive’s logic board got very hot very quickly! So I quickly turned that off.
So guess what I will have to do is buy another 320gb, swap the logic boards, grab the data off it, swap the boards back and biff it
